WebGraphing Rational Functions Let us graph a rational function f (x) = (x + 1) / (x - 2). We follow the above steps and graph this function. Domain = {x ∈ R x ≠ 2} ; Range = {y ∈ R y ≠ 1}. To understand how to find the domain and range of a rational function, click here. Its x-intercept is (-1, 0) and y-intercept is (0, -0.5). There are no holes. Step 2: You need to find the … church roofing grants pass oregonWebApr 13, 2011 · Rational Functions Rational Functions A rational function is the algebraic equivalent of a rational number. Recall that a rational number is one that can be expressed as a ratio of integers: p/q.
